After facing a challenging stretch of games, Caleb Williams delivered a standout performance in Week 10, marking a significant turnaround for the young quarterback. Following a chaotic victory against the Cincinnati Bengals in Week 9, Bears offensive coordinator Ben Johnson delivered a succinct message to his team: don’t apologize for a win. The Bears have managed to secure a couple of gritty victories recently, and in the NFL, it’s clear that wins are what truly count, especially in the playoff race.

At 6-3, the Bears find themselves in a rare and favorable position within the NFC North, now tied with the Lions for the division lead, edging ahead of both the Packers and the Vikings. This resurgence is not just about winning; it’s also about the maturation of their second-year quarterback, Caleb Williams. His growth is crucial for the long-term success of the franchise, making his recent slump after the bye week all the more concerning as signs of his earlier struggles re-emerged.

While it’s understood that Williams may have a few more rough outings this season, his performance over the past two weeks has been a welcome relief for Bears fans. His role in the thrilling comeback against the Giants in Week 10 could be considered his finest outing as a professional, showcasing his ability to lead under pressure. For now, he has reclaimed the top spot in the Chicago Bears player power rankings.

Top of the Rankings: Caleb Williams

1. Caleb Williams (Last week: 5)
Bears fans can finally breathe easy regarding outside distractions, quarterback evaluations, and comparisons to the upcoming 2024 draft class. Chicago has its franchise quarterback, and Williams proved to be the linchpin in the Bears’ victory over a determined Giants team. Despite dealing with a handful of dropped passes and some questionable play calls from Johnson, Williams orchestrated two crucial scoring drives in the final minutes of the game. He capped off the comeback with a 17-yard scramble for the game-winning touchdown.

Although his statistical performance—220 passing yards and one touchdown—might not jump off the page, Williams displayed poise and command of the offense that belied his experience. He navigated the game calmly, embodying the demeanor of a seasoned veteran while steering his team through adversity.

As the Bears continue their push through the season, it’s clear that with Williams at the helm, they have a fighting chance. His leadership on the field will be pivotal as they strive to solidify their place in the playoff race, and for the fans, there’s plenty of reason for optimism moving forward.
